Not Present Not Present Proceeding: (IN CHAMBERS) ORDER TO SHOW CAUSE RE: DISMISSAL FOR LACK OF PROSECUTION Plaintiff(s) are ORDERED to show cause why this case should not be dismissed for lack of prosecution. Link v. Wabash R. Co.,

370 U.S. 626

(1962) (Court has inherent power to dismiss for lack of prosecution on its own motion).

The docket reflects that Plaintiff(s) are not actively pursuing this matter. Plaintiff(s) can satisfy this order by filing a Status Report, not to exceed 4 pages, setting forth the current status of the litigation.

The Court, on its own motion, orders Plaintiff(s) to show cause, in writing, on or before July 27, 2023, why this action should not be dismissed for lack of prosecution. This matter will stand submitted upon the filing of Plaintiff(s) response. See Fed. R. Civ. P. 78. Failure to respond will be deemed consent to the dismissal of the action.

IT IS SO ORDERED.
